【Kyoto Furoshiki Wrapping Cloth: katakata Cats and Birds】
In Japan before modern times, black cats were considered "Maneki-neko" (beckoning cats), symbols of warding off evil, bringing good luck, and prosperity in business. Birds, by their ability to "lure customers," were also seen as auspicious charms for business success. The artist has skillfully combined these two elements to create this pattern, brimming with stories and blessings.
【About the Artists: kata kata】
The unique patterns on this furoshiki are by the Japanese stencil dyeing artist duo, kata kata.
Composed of Takeshi Matsunaga and Chie Takai, they specialize in traditional techniques like "katazome" (stencil dyeing) for their creations on fabric and paper.
Their style is characterized by the warmth of handmade craftsmanship, and they share their work through numerous exhibitions and joint shows.
Their designs are not only beloved in Japan but also widely popular overseas, making them a key collaborative series for Musubi.
【The Origin and Charm of Furoshiki】
"Furoshiki" (風呂敷) is a traditional wrapping cloth originating from Japan's Muromachi period, which has evolved into an eco-friendly, stylish, and ingenious cultural symbol. It can replace traditional paper bags and, through different tying methods, transform into a unique tote bag, gift wrap, or home decor, showcasing your creativity and taste.
